Evertz Technologies Limited is a leading provider of video and audio infrastructure solutions, catering to the production, post-production, broadcast, and telecommunications sectors. The company operates in the highly specialized communication equipment industry, offering a comprehensive portfolio of products including encoders, decoders, routers, and media servers. Its revenue model is driven by hardware sales and software solutions, serving content creators, broadcasters, and television service providers globally. Evertz has established a strong market position through its technological expertise and reliability, particularly in live media production and IP-based workflows. The company’s focus on innovation and integration of software-defined networking (SDN) solutions positions it well in an industry transitioning toward IP and cloud-based infrastructures. With a presence in Canada, the United States, and international markets, Evertz competes with both niche players and larger technology firms, leveraging its deep industry knowledge and customer relationships to maintain a competitive edge.
Evertz reported revenue of CAD 514.6 million for FY 2024, with net income of CAD 70.2 million, reflecting a net margin of approximately 13.6%. The company generated CAD 144.7 million in operating cash flow, demonstrating strong cash conversion efficiency. Capital expenditures were modest at CAD 9.6 million, indicating a capital-light business model with high returns on invested capital.
The company’s diluted EPS of CAD 0.91 underscores its earnings power, supported by a disciplined cost structure and high-margin product offerings. Evertz maintains robust capital efficiency, as evidenced by its ability to generate significant operating cash flow relative to its revenue base, with minimal reliance on debt financing.
Evertz boasts a solid balance sheet with CAD 86.3 million in cash and equivalents and total debt of CAD 23.2 million, resulting in a net cash position. This strong liquidity profile provides flexibility for strategic investments, dividends, and share repurchases. The company’s low leverage and healthy cash reserves underscore its financial stability.
Evertz has demonstrated consistent profitability, supported by steady demand for its broadcast and telecommunications solutions. The company pays a dividend of CAD 0.79 per share, reflecting a commitment to returning capital to shareholders. Growth is driven by technological advancements in IP-based and cloud solutions, though the pace may be tempered by the mature nature of its core markets.
With a market capitalization of CAD 891 million and a beta of 0.69, Evertz is perceived as a relatively stable investment within the technology sector. The stock’s valuation reflects expectations of steady, albeit moderate, growth, aligned with the company’s niche market focus and proven execution.
Evertz’s strategic advantages lie in its deep industry expertise, innovative product portfolio, and strong customer relationships. The company is well-positioned to benefit from the ongoing shift toward IP and cloud-based media workflows. While competition remains intense, Evertz’s focus on high-quality, reliable solutions should sustain its market position. The outlook is stable, with potential upside from increased adoption of next-generation broadcasting technologies.
